I'm also interested in beta testing MBR1000 with the Huawei EC168A modem in Alltel network. Currently the MBR1000 doesn't support the EC168A.
Plugged directly into my laptop, the Huawei EC168 was significantly faster than the Pantech UM175. The latter is supported by the MBR1000, but would really like to stick with the faster EC168.
The MBR1000 & Alltel are replacing a Belkin router on Wildblue, connected by wireless to 2 laptops and by ethernet to 4 desktops. (Typically they are not all accessing the internet simutaneously but quite often 2-3). |

I'd be willing to participate in the beta as well. I've worked in IT networking for more than 20 years, and have been using EVDO, RF packet radios, and satellite for several years now in areas where there aren't other options. Once I found how well the Cradlepoints work, as compared to even the other EVDO products, I'm hooked.
My staff and I travel with CTR350's and CTR500's with several devices including a Novatel EV720 (m6800a), several Pantech UM150's, Moto Q's, and various models of Blackberries. I have one unit at home that usually get's -59db with a signal quality of 31, and another unit that frequently gets used in areas where the signal strength is hardly usable. The only frustrating problem I've experienced is with the CTR500 - some units regularly kick all wifi users off, and the reconnect them every few minutes.
I'd be glad to help if needed. |
